Power Inductor Operates At +180°C

Tailored for high-temperature automotive environments, the HA55 Series power inductor features a powdered-iron-alloy core material and operates at temperatures from -40°C to +180°C. Also desirable for industrial applications, the inductors feature low DCR characteristics and offer inductance values ranging from 7 µH to 20 µH with a recommended frequency up to 400 kHz. Current ratings range from 40A to 60A with a saturation current from 43A to 50A. Typical DC resistance for the inductor ranges from 1.7 to 3.35 milliOhms. Typical pricing for the HA55 Series ranges from $4.20 to $5.95 each/10,000. BI TECHNOLOGIES, Fullerton, CA. (714) 447-2759.
